Bring the wonder of spatial depth into your classroom with our exclusive Art perspective poster year 4 greater depth resource. Designed specifically for Year 4 pupils ready for a challenge, this vibrant visual aid introduces the fundamental concepts of linear perspective, horizon lines, and vanishing points. By using Zara the zebra as our guide, students explore how artists manipulate scale and positioning to create the illusion of three-dimensional space on a two-dimensional surface.

While standard Year 4 lessons focus on observational drawing, this greater depth resource pushes learners to experiment with converging lines and atmospheric perspective, bridging the gap between simple composition and complex spatial representation.
Teachers can use this resource as a focal point for a whole-class demonstration before transitioning into independent practice. The poster serves as an excellent reference point for students as they attempt to render architectural structures or expansive landscapes. Because this Art perspective poster year 4 greater depth is tailored for gifted and talented learners, it includes high-order thinking prompts that encourage critical analysis. Pupils are challenged to justify their creative choices, explain why objects appear smaller at a distance, and predict how shifting the vanishing point would alter the viewer’s experience.
